Install the mounting brackets. The brackets may not be necessary for the particular model of air conditioner and, if so, will not be included. Follow the instructions regarding the mounting hardware as it may vary. Use a screwdriver to secure the mounting hardware in place in the window. Use a level to ensure and adjust as needed.
Place the air conditioning unit into the window. Open the window wider than necessary for ease. Have someone help you lift and put the unit in place. Close the window as much as possible to hold the unit in place once mounted. Do not place the unit past the mounting bracket or built-in frame.
Slide out the accordion side panels to close off the remaining window opening. Use a screw and screwdriver to secure the side panels in place, preventing any leaks where the cool air can easily escape.
Install the included angle brackets in the upper sash of the window. This prevents the window from randomly opening and potentially allowing the unit to fall out of place. Use a screwdriver to install the brackets.
Insert a foam strip in the gap where the upper and lower sashes overlap. The gap and overlap is created because the window is technically open -- the foam strip helps to prevent the cool air escaping through this opening.
Plug the unit into an electrical outlet to begin use.
